Roof damage inspection services involve a thorough assessment of a property's roofing system to identify existing issues and potential vulnerabilities. These inspections typically include a visual examination of the roof's surface, flashing, gutters, and attic spaces to detect signs of wear, leaks, or structural problems. Some providers may also utilize specialized tools or equipment, such as drones or moisture meters, to gain a more detailed understanding of the roof’s condition. The goal is to gather comprehensive information that helps property owners understand the current state of their roof and determine necessary repairs or maintenance.
This service helps address common roofing problems such as leaks, missing or damaged shingles, sagging areas, and deterioration caused by weather exposure. Identifying these issues early can prevent more extensive damage to the property’s interior, such as water intrusion, mold growth, and structural weakening. Roof damage inspections also assist in detecting underlying issues that may not be immediately visible, such as compromised underlayment or hidden leaks. By pinpointing problems before they escalate, property owners can plan timely repairs, potentially saving money and extending the lifespan of their roofs.

Inspection Fees - Roof damage inspections typically cost between $150 and $400, depending on the property size and complexity. Some providers may charge a flat fee or hourly rates within this range. Costs can vary based on local market conditions and inspection scope.
Additional Diagnostic Services - If further testing or detailed assessments are needed, prices may range from $200 to $600. This includes services like moisture testing or structural evaluations, with prices influenced by the extent of the inspection required.
Repair Estimates - After inspection, contractors often provide repair estimates that can vary from $1,000 to over $10,000. The final cost depends on the severity of damage and necessary repairs, which local pros will detail during assessment.
Consultation Costs - Some service providers offer consultation services at no extra charge, while others may charge between $100 and $300 for expert advice. Contacting local pros can help clarify the specific costs for roof damage assessments in Chester, PA, and nearby areas.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are signs of roof damage? Common indicators include missing or cracked shingles, water stains on ceilings, and increased granules in gutters.
Why should I schedule a roof damage inspection? An inspection can identify issues early, helping to prevent further damage and costly repairs.
How often should roof inspections be performed? It is recommended to have a roof inspected after severe weather events or at least once a year.
What types of damage can roof inspections detect? Inspections can reveal storm damage, leaks, structural issues, and deterioration of roofing materials.
How do local pros perform a roof damage inspection? They assess the roof’s condition from the ground and roof surface, looking for visible damage and potential problem areas.
